Ethiopian Airlines Resumes Flights To Monrovia

After more than a decade away from Liberia’s airspace, Ethiopian Airlines has officially resumed flights to and fro the country. The Boeing 787-8 flight landed at the Roberts International Airport on Saturday, November 30, 2024, from Addis Ababa with 261 passengers onboard which marked a significant milestone in the country’s aviation industry. ‘Charting A New Course’…LNBA Elects New Officials; Achieves Gender Parity

The Liberia National Bar Association (LNBA) on Saturday, November 30, 2024, elected a new code of officers to steer its leadership for the next three years. Those elected are Cllr. Bono Varmah, President, Cllr. F. Juah Lawson, Vice President, Cllr. Elisha Forkeyoh, Secretary General, and Atty. Yemi Shobayo-Williams, Treasurer. US$650K Fagonda River Dam In Sight

Agriculture Minister Dr. J. Alexander Nuetah has announced a US$650, 000 project to reconstruct the Fagonda River Dam in Lofa County.  This game-changing initiative will create an advanced irrigation system to support over 250 acres of farmland, boosting rice production and enhancing food security in Liberia. Government Electricity Debt Hits US$18M…LEC Boss Monie Captan Discloses

The Liberia Electricity Cooperation (LEC) has disclosed that as of October 31, 2024, the Government of Liberia owes the corporation US $18,975,049 for power consumption.
